One of them is Paul Fussell's Class: A Guide Through the American Status System. I wouldn't discuss about the book but just read this from her article:-
The top class, according to Fussell, drink Scotch on the rocks in a tumbler decorated with sailboats and say "Grandfather died"; middles pronounce it""Martooni" and say "Grandma passed away";proles drink domestic beer in a can and say "Uncle was taken to Jesus"
